на go) и у меня назрел вопрос.
Есть сервис, который на get запрос отдает массив json объектов в пользовательское приложение. Пользователь должен выбирать один из объектов и дальше этот объект нужно сохранить в бд. Как в данном случае лучше валидировать то, что пришло от пользователя? Хочется, чтобы объект, который пришел обратно на сервер, соответствовал одному из объектов, изначально переданных пользователю.
Есть мысль считать хеш от каждого объекта в массиве и хранить соответствие (запрос->массив хешей) какое-то время.
Возможно есть более элегантное решение?
Не надо ничего валидировать, пусть пользователь присылает не объект, а id объекта
Обсуждают сегодня